Comprehending Pain Relief Capsules
Pain relief pills are oral medications designed to reduce different types of physical discomfort. Compared to liquids or topical creams, pills provide unique benefits:
- Convenience: They are simple to bring and require no measurement.
- Dosage Accuracy: Each capsule includes a precise quantity of active pharmaceutical components (APIs).
- Taste Masking: Capsules frame bitter medications, making them easier to swallow.
- Extended Release: Some advanced formulas permit for slow release of the Medication Delivery USA over a number of hours.
Typically, non-prescription (OTC) pain relief capsules fall into a few primary chemical categories, each working differently within the body.

Not all pain is developed equal, and neither is every capsule. Selecting the proper product depends heavily on the source and nature of the discomfort.
1. For Inflammatory Pain (Joints, Muscles, Injuries)
If the pain stems from inflammation-- such as tendonitis, a sprained ankle, or arthritis-- NSAIDs like ibuprofen or naproxen are usually the favored option. Because they target the origin of inflammation (swelling and tissue irritation), they tend to be more efficient for musculoskeletal concerns than basic analgesics.
2. For General Aches and Fevers
When handling a fever, general malaise, or moderate headaches without considerable swelling, acetaminophen is frequently suggested. It is likewise the go-to alternative for people who have delicate stomachs or a history of gastrointestinal bleeding, which can be intensified by NSAIDs.
3. For Migraines and Severe Headaches
Specialized mix pills frequently work best for migraines. These solutions often bundle acetaminophen, aspirin, and a little dosage of caffeine. The caffeine not just constricts capillary in the brain (assisting to reduce headache pain) but also speeds up the absorption of the main pain-relieving ingredients.
Best Practices for Safe Consumption
While pain relief pills are widely readily available without a prescription, they are still powerful medications that require careful handling. Misuse can lead to serious health problems.
- Constantly Read the Label: Check the active components, recommended dosage, and optimum day-to-day limitations. Double-dosing can happen inadvertently if a person takes a cold medicine which contains acetaminophen along with a devoted pain pill.
- Mind the Duration: OTC painkiller are indicated for short-term relief. If pain continues for more than a few days (or a fever lasts more than three days), it is essential to consult a healthcare specialist.
- Consider Pre-existing Conditions: Individuals with hypertension, kidney illness, liver problems, or a history of stomach ulcers need to consult a physician before taking specific pain pills.
- Stay Hydrated: Taking capsules with a complete glass of water helps ensure appropriate dissolution and decreases the threat of the capsule accommodations in the esophagus or irritating the stomach lining.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)Q1: Can I take ibuprofen and acetaminophen together?
A: Yes, under particular situations, medical professionals might recommend rotating in between ibuprofen and acetaminophen due to the fact that they come from various drug classes and work via various systems. Nevertheless, users need to never ever combine them without professional medical guidance to avoid unexpected overdose or pressure on the liver and kidneys.
Q2: Are liquid-filled gel capsules faster-acting than conventional tough tablets?
A: Generally, yes. Liquid-filled softgel pills typically dissolve faster in the stomach than compressed tough tablets, which can result in quicker absorption of the active ingredient into the blood stream.
Q3: Can long-lasting use of pain relief capsules be damaging?
A: Yes. Prolonged or extreme usage of NSAIDs can result in intestinal bleeding, ulcers, and kidney problems. Long-term overuse of acetaminophen can trigger severe, sometimes permanent liver damage. Always use the least expensive reliable dose for the quickest possible period.
Q4: Should I take pain relief pills on an empty stomach?
A: It depends upon the component. NSAIDs (like ibuprofen and naproxen) can aggravate the stomach lining and are best taken with food, milk, or an antacid. Acetaminophen is usually less annoying to the stomach and can usually be taken with or without food.
